Service Provider to: "Provide technical assistance to conduct a complementary Rapid Market Analysis of the Food processing sector in the framework of the Manzuma Project in Jordan".
The objective of this assignment is to conduct a targeted Rapid Market Analysis (RMA) of the food processing sector in Jordan, with the aim of complementing existing data, addressing current information gaps, and identifying concrete operational entry points for the Manzuma project to design effective market-led interventions. This analysis will build on prior work, particularly:
- The ILO’s Market Systems Analysis on SMEs’ business incentives to contribute to social insurance schemes in Jordan (2025), which provides valuable insights into SME decision-making processes related to business operations and workforce management, including in the food processing sector.
- The GIZ’s Jordan’s Food Processing Sector Analysis And Strategy For Sectoral Improvement Market Analysis (2019), which outlines the key challenges and opportunities faced by SMEs in accessing export markets.
Rather than offering a broad overview of the sector or duplicating existing research, this Rapid Market Analysis will focus on unpacking specific, in-depth research questions that remain unanswered—particularly those related to the inclusion and employment dynamics of Syrian refugees and vulnerable Jordanian workers. The analysis will also deliver updated, action-oriented recommendations on priority areas for intervention and potential partnerships for the Manzuma project. To achieve the above-mentioned objectives, the service provider and the ILO team will apply the ILO’s ‘value chain development for decent work’ and the ‘Approach to inclusive market systems for Refugees and Host Communities (AIMS)’ methodologies and adjust these in a way that will place SMEs and their incentives to contribute to social insurance schemes at the centre of the research.
